Essential Terms Related to Trucking Accident Cases

Familiarity with key legal and industry terms can help clients better understand their cases. Below are important definitions that clarify the trucking accident claim process and considerations involved.

Negligence

Negligence refers to the failure to exercise reasonable care, which results in harm to another person. In trucking accidents, negligence might include distracted driving, speeding, or violating safety regulations.

Liability

Liability is the legal responsibility for damages caused by an accident. Determining liability in trucking cases can involve the driver, trucking company, or third parties.

Damages

Damages refer to the monetary compensation sought for losses such as medical bills, lost income, pain, and suffering resulting from the accident.

Commercial Trucking Regulations

These are federal and state rules that govern the operation of commercial trucks, including hours of service, vehicle maintenance, and driver qualifications.

Frequently Asked Questions About Trucking Accident Cases in Royal Oak

What should I do immediately after a trucking accident in Royal Oak?

First, ensure your safety and seek medical attention if needed. It is important to report the accident to the proper authorities and document the scene with photos and witness information. Avoid admitting fault or discussing the accident details with insurance adjusters without legal guidance. Contacting a qualified lawyer promptly can help protect your rights and build a strong claim.

In Michigan,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ims arising from trucking accidents is generally three years from the date of the accident. It is essential to begin your claim promptly to ensure all necessary evidence is preserved and deadlines are met. Consulting with a legal professional early helps avoid missing important filing requirements.

Michigan follows a comparative negligence rule, which means you may still recover damages even if you share some fault for the accident. However, your compensation will be reduced by your percentage of responsibility. An experienced legal team can help assess fault and advocate for the highest possible recovery based on the circumstances.

Yes, trucking companies can be held liable for accidents caused by their drivers, especially if negligence in hiring, training, or maintenance contributed to the crash. Claims often involve multiple parties, and legal representation helps identify all responsible entities.

Federal and state trucking regulations set safety standards that drivers and companies must follow. Violations of these rules can support your claim by demonstrating negligence. Understanding these regulations is important for building a strong legal argument.
